For the 2025 school year, there are 3 public schools serving 802 students in 45346, OH.
The top ranked public schools in 45346, OH are Tri-village High School and Tri-village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public schools in zipcode 45346 have an average math proficiency score of 76% (versus the Ohio public school average of 52%), and reading proficiency score of 75% (versus the 60% statewide average). Schools in 45346, OH have an average ranking of 9/10, which is in the top 20% of Ohio public schools.
Minority enrollment is 4%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Ohio public school average of 34% (majority Black).
